The past decade of both economic crises in Europe and North America as well as an extraordinary museum boom in many Asian countries has led to new questions and concepts for future museum buildings. This book investigates this paradigm change by presenting 20 recent and future museum projects on all continents. Num Pages: illustrations. BIC Classification: 3JM; AMD; AMG; GM. CD-ROM. Barry Bolton's "New General Catalogue of the Ants of the World" was the first attempt to collect all taxonomic decisions for ants. Expanding on Bolton's work, this book incorporates the taxonomic papers on various ant species and includes a CD, which allows every species to be linked to the primary citation and to relevant taxonomic literature.
